Monday, Nov. 29, 1954
Program Preview
For the week starting Wednesday, (Nov. 24. Times are E.S.T., subject to change.
Disneyland (Wed. 7:30 p.m., ABC). Bobby Driscoll in So Dear to My Heart
Kraft TV Theater (Wed. 9 p.m., NBC). Jane Austen's Emma, with Felicia Montealegre.
Home (Thurs. 11 a.m., NBC). Macy's Thanksgiving Day Parade.
Football (Thurs. 1:55 p.m., ABC). Missouri v. Maryland.
Dear Phoebe (Fri. 9:30 p.m., NBC). Peter Lawford in a comedy series.
Person to Person (Fri. 10:30 p.m., CBS). Ed Murrow interviews Actor Maurice Evans, Singer Joni James.
Texaco Star Theater (Sat. 9:30 p.m., NBC). Guest: Margaret Truman.
George Gobel Show (Sat. 10 p.m., NBC). With Charles Coburn.
Hall of Fame (Sun. 4 p.m., NBC). Macbeth, with Maurice Evans, Judith Anderson.
The Search (Sun. 4:30 p.m., CBS). Filmed flight into the eye of a hurricane.
Toast of the Town (Sun. 8 p.m., CBS). Numbers from the hit musical, Fanny with Ezio Pinza.
Medic (Mon. 9 p.m., NBC). Documentary about a musician who grows deaf.
RADIO
Make Up Your Mind (Thurs. 11:30 a.m., CBS). Guest: Constance Collier.
Football (Thurs. 1:45 p.m., ABC). Penn v. Cornell.
Football (Sat. 1:30 p.m., NBC). Army v. Navy.
Boston Symphony (Sat. 8:30 p.m., NBC). With Pianist Alexander Brailowsky
New York Philharmonic (Sun. 2:30 p.m., CBS). Conductor: Bruno Walter.
On a Sunday Afternoon (Sun. 4:05 p.m., CBS). With Cole Porter.
Jack Benny Show (Sun. 7 p.m., CBS). Dennis Day visits a psychiatrist.
His Finest Hour (Sun. 7 p.m., NBC). Tribute to Sir Winston Churchill in honor of his 80th birthday.
